On convex probes such as the S-VAW4-7, the curved acoustic window wears unevenly under pressure-heavy scanning; lens condition is the first thing to check when image quality drops.
Common failure modes for the S-VAW4-7
Match what you are seeing against the table below. The right-hand column reflects how faults of this kind typically assess – the actual verdict always depends on the individual probe.
| What you see | Likely cause | Typically repairable? |
|---|---|---|
| Cable jacket cracked, wrinkled or discolored | Surface jacket wear – the conductors inside are often still good | Usually repairable |
| Split seams or impact marks on the probe body | Impact damage; housing can usually be replaced or resealed | Usually repairable |
| Visible nicks, grooves or staining on the lens surface | Mechanical wear or disinfectant damage to the lens | Usually repairable |
| Bubbles or lifting at the lens face | Lens delamination from the acoustic stack | Usually repairable |
| Image cuts out when the cable is flexed | Broken internal conductors in the cable | Case by case |
| Dark bands or dropout lines in the image | Failed transducer elements or a broken conductor in the cable | Case by case |
| Large areas of the array not firing | Extensive element loss across the acoustic stack | Usually not economical |
Check these before you ship the probe
- Check the strain reliefs at both ends for splits, stiffness or separation from the cable.
- Run the system’s built-in probe test or element check if your console provides one.
- Flex the cable gently along its length while imaging – intermittent dropout points to broken conductors.
- Photograph the complete manufacturer label – the exact revision matters for parts compatibility.
- Inspect the lens face under good light for cuts, bubbles, lifting edges or discoloration.
Repair, exchange or replace — which applies to your S-VAW4-7
Whether a S-VAW4-7 is worth repairing depends on the damage scope: localized lens, cable, strain relief and connector faults are routine repairs, while widespread element loss usually is not economical. An exchange unit can bridge the gap when downtime matters, and replacement becomes rational when repair cost approaches replacement value. A written assessment settles this per probe – condition, not model, decides it.
